Auckland, New Zealand: Hallard Press , 1980. Very scarce copy of authors second collection of poetry. Gadd is a prolific writer who has been published in a host of literary journals including Landfall and the Listener. He writes satirical poems from the perspective of NZ history. New Zealand Poetry with a section on Maori subjects and another lampooning Rob Muldoon and his Government.
